Community Welfare Wing
The Community Welfare Wing plays the role of a coordinator and
facilitator by providing guidance and support for the redressal of
grievances of the large number of Indian nationals residing in areas
under the consular jurisdiction of the Embassy of India, Riyadh.
Services Offered by CW Wing
The services cover a wide canvass of welfare measures including:
- Authentication and verification of employment contracts before
the worker arrives in Saudi Arabia.
- Attestation of documents pertaining to recruitment from
India
- Counseling and assistance to Indian workers in settling
disputes related to work contracts.
- Assistance to workers in claiming legal dues relating to
termination benefits.
- Registration of death of an Indian national.
- Assistance in follow up work with sponsors & local
authorities for the earliest burial / transportation to India of
mortal remains.
- Issue of No Objection Certificate for the local burial or
transportation to India of mortal remains of deceased Indian
nationals.
- Assistance to family members of Indian nationals in claiming
death compensation due to accidental or other unnatural deaths.
- Attending various Shariah Courts for the settlement of death
compensation claims of deceased Indian nationals who authorize
the Embassy with their Power of Attorney.
- Realization of death compensation claims from Saudi
authorities and repatriation of the same to India to the next of
kin of deceased Indian nationals, through district authorities.
- Assistance for taking up problems of a personal nature back
home, of the Indian nationals in Saudi Arabia, with the
authorities concerned in India for redressal.

Labour Disputes
If any Indian national faces any dispute with his sponsor
regarding non-payment of wages, leave, end-of-service benefits,
etc., they can contact the Community Welfare Wing to sort out their
problems. The officials of the Community Welfare Wing try to sort
out their problems by correspondence and through discussions with
the sponsor for an amicable settlement. If no agreement or
settlement is reached through discussions with sponsor, the matter
is taken up through the Ministry of Foreign Affairs. Even after
that, if the matter remains unresolved, the Indian nationals have to
file the case with the Labour Court concerned. Community Welfare
Wing provides free Interpreter service for cases at Riyadh Labour
Court, subject to availability of personnel and the request being
made well in advance. It is always good for all Indian nationals to
keep copies of their contract, passport and iqama with them and also
with their family in India to safeguard their interest.
Indian Workers Welfare Fund (IWWF)
The Embassy in Riyadh and the Consulate General in Jeddah have
established an Indian Workers Welfare Fund (IWWF) to provide relief
and assistance to needy Indian workers, including repatriation to
India, and ex-gratia relief to destitute families of the workers in
exceptional case.
